About This Book

A collection of short fairy stories told in a plain, storyteller’s voice that transposes traditional magical motifs into Australian landscapes. The tales feature enchanted wells, flying carriages, sprites and royal rescues, blending whimsical fantasy with local flora and setting details. Framed as evening stories for children, the pieces use lyrical description, gentle moral underscoring and folk-style humor; some are brief fables while others develop into small adventures or curious encounters with enchanted beings, and simple illustrations accompany the text to enhance the mood.
